Bidirectional optical flow and perceptual hash based fingertip tracking method

A technology of perceptual hashing and bidirectional light, applied in the input/output process of data processing, the input/output of user/computer interaction, and image data processing, etc., can solve problems such as poor fingertip tracking effect

Active Publication Date: 2016-01-20
SOUTH CHINA UNIV OF TECH
View PDF5 Cites 10 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0007] The purpose of the present invention is to make up for the deficiencies of the existing fingertip detection and tracking technology, and to provide a fingertip tracking method based on two-way optical flow and perceptual hashing, which can effectively realize continuous tracking of fingertips in complex environments. Sexual tracking, while avoiding the problem of poor fingertip tracking effect due to discontinuous fingertip tracking trajectory

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Bidirectional optical flow and perceptual hash based fingertip tracking method
  • Bidirectional optical flow and perceptual hash based fingertip tracking method
  • Bidirectional optical flow and perceptual hash based fingertip tracking method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ment

[0056] Such as Figure 1 to Figure 6 As shown, a fingertip tracking method based on two-way optical flow and perceptual hashing of the present invention is used to continuously track the fingertips of the hand; this includes the following three steps:

[0057] The first step is to capture the scene information, calculate the dense optical flow information corresponding to the scene information, and perform binarization preprocessing to obtain the scene image containing the hand area; then construct a skin color filter to process the scene image containing the hand area Segmentation of the hand area to obtain the hand area;

[0058] The second step is to sample the contour of the hand area, perform vector dot product and cross product calculation on each contour point to eliminate the contour points that are not fingertips, and obtain candidate fingertip points; then set the threshold according to the geometric characteristics of the fingertips, Count the number of non-fingert...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a bidirectional optical flow and perceptual hash based fingertip tracking method. The method comprises the steps of S1, calculating dense optical flow information corresponding to scene information, and constructing a skin color filter to acquire a hand area; S2, carrying out vector dot product and cross multiplication calculation on each contour point so as to remove non-fingertip contour points, detecting the position of a fingertip point according to geometrical features of the fingertip, and acquiring fingertip contour points; and S3, calculating the fingertip contour points by using a bidirectional pyramid optical flow algorithm, acquiring bidirectionally matched fingertip contour points so as to carry out estimation on a fingertip moving area, generating a 64-bit perceptual hash sequence by adopting a perceptual hash algorithm, and matching the 64-bit perceptual hash sequence with a fingertip hash sequence template, wherein the maximum matching area is a fingertip area; and judging whether a next turn of fingertip tracking is carried out or not, and realizing fingertip continuous tracking. The method provided by the invention can effectively realize continuous tracking for the fingertip in a complex environment, and a problem of poor fingertip tracking effect caused by discontinuous fingertip tracking trajectory is avoided at the same time.

Description

technical field [0001] The invention relates to the technical field of image processing and analysis, and more specifically, relates to a fingertip tracking method based on bidirectional optical flow and perceptual hashing. Background technique [0002] Traditional human-computer interaction mainly completes the information exchange between human and computing through media such as mouse or keyboard. The media of this interaction method needs to occupy a certain amount of space and is very inconvenient to use. Today, with the development of computer science and artificial intelligence technology, human-computer interaction continues to develop. The application of technologies such as touch screen, speech recognition, and computer vision makes human-computer interaction systems more and more convenient and friendly. [0003] As an important part of computer vision-based human-computer interaction systems, fingertip tracking has attracted more and more researchers' attention i...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06T7/20G06F3/01
CPCG06F3/017G06T7/20
Inventor 康文雄吴桂乐
Owner SOUTH CHINA UNIV OF T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products